Young Harris City Zoning Code

ARTICLE X

- LEGAL STATUS PROVISIONS

Section 10.1. - Conflict with other laws.

Whenever the regulations of this ordinance require a greater width or size of yards, or impose other more restrictive standards than are required in or under any other statute, the requirement of this ordinance shall govern. Whenever the provisions of any other statute require more restrictive standards than are required by this ordinance, the provisions of such statute shall govern.

Section 10.2. - Separability.

Should any section, provision, paragraph, sentence, phrase or clause of this ordinance be declared invalid or unconstitutional by any court of competent jurisdiction, such declaration shall not affect the validity of this ordinance as a whole, or any part thereof, which is not specifically declared to be invalid or unconstitutional.

Section 10.3. - Repeals of conflicting ordinances.

All ordinances and parts of ordinances in conflict with this ordinance are herewith repealed. All violations of prior ordinances shall be enforceable and such fines or punishment authorized under a prior ordinance under which a violation occurred shall be imposed as provided under the prior ordinance.

Section 10.4. - Reversionary clause.

This ordinance replaces the city's prior zoning ordinance existing and in effect immediately prior to the adoption of this ordinance. In the event all of this ordinance is struck down as void, unconstitutional or invalid, that prior ordinance shall be considered to not have been repealed, and shall therefore still be in effect.

Section 10.5. - Effective date.

The public welfare demanding, this ordinance shall take effect and shall be in force immediately upon adoption.
